Panduit FRT12X4W4LYL FiberRunner Horizontal T-Splice Fitting
The Panduit FRT12X4W4LYL creates a 90° horizontal branch in 12x4 FiberRunner pathways, stepping down to a 4x4 outlet for fiber distribution zones in telecom central offices and data centers. When your backbone run needs to feed a perpendicular equipment row or branch to a cross-connect area, this polycarbonate/ABS fitting maintains protected pathways without forcing technicians to break containment or improvise exposed drops. Yellow high-visibility construction speeds moves-adds-changes by making the pathway immediately recognizable during service calls. UL 2024A listed for fiber optic cable routing assemblies and NEBS Level 3 tested per Telcordia GR-63-CORE.

Fiber infrastructure in telecom facilities and data centers demands structured pathways that protect bend radius while allowing technicians to trace routes visually during maintenance. The FRT12X4W4LYL solves the common problem of branching a 12x4 backbone pathway to feed equipment rows, patch panels, or splice enclosures at right angles without dropping into ladder rack or exposing cable. The fitting's 4x4 outlet provides sufficient capacity for typical floor distribution — 144-288 fibers in high-density ribbon cable, or mixed loose-tube and breakout assemblies — while the stepped-down size signals the transition from backbone to branch. Polycarbonate/ABS construction survives the thermal cycling of HVAC failures and the mechanical stress of adjacent equipment installation without cracking. The 17.61-inch overall length and 12.96-inch width provide generous internal radius for 900µm tight-buffered and 2mm-3mm breakout cables, eliminating kink points that cause insertion loss or long-term fiber fatigue. Yellow coloring is standard in many carrier facilities for single-mode pathways, making this fitting immediately recognizable during after-hours troubleshooting when a technician needs to identify the route from a failed circuit back to the main distribution frame.
Installation pairs with Panduit's FiberRunner mounting hardware and requires no specialized tools beyond standard fasteners for the facility's overhead support structure. The fitting accepts FiberRunner 12x4 sections on the main run and FiberRunner 4x4 sections on the branch outlet, with snap-together joints that allow disassembly for cable additions without dismantling entire pathway runs. Field technicians appreciate the ability to remove a single fitting to add a new fiber bundle, then reassemble the pathway in minutes rather than hours of conduit threading. The design accommodates optional distribution splice trays inside the fitting body when the branch point coincides with a permanent splice location, consolidating two infrastructure functions into one physical point and reducing the number of discrete enclosures mounted overhead. For facilities requiring seismic bracing, the UL 2024A listing and NEBS Level 3 qualification confirm the fitting has passed shake-table testing and can be incorporated into braced overhead pathways without voiding compliance. Data center managers building or expanding structured cabling systems will recognize this as the standard solution for creating horizontal branches in raised-floor or overhead ladder environments where exposed fiber is unacceptable and future capacity planning requires visible, accessible pathways.
Supplied as a single fitting. The UL 2024A listing covers both plenum and non-plenum applications, though the specific flame rating depends on the installation environment and local AHJ interpretation — consult your jurisdiction's electrical inspector when planning plenum pathway installations. The RoHS compliance allows use in EU-regulated facilities and simplifies procurement for multinational carriers managing standardized bill-of-materials across regions. This fitting is engineered specifically for the FiberRunner 12x4 system — verify your existing pathway sections are Panduit FiberRunner 12x4 profile before ordering, as the snap-fit joints are not compatible with generic cable tray or third-party raceway systems.
